Subject: [PATCH] x86/copy_user.S: Remove zero byte check before copy user buffer.

From: Fenghua Yu <fenghua.yu@...el.com>

Operation of rep movsb instruction handles zero byte copy. As pointed out by
Linus, there is no need to check zero size in kernel. Removing this redundant
check saves a few cycles in copy user functions.
